ATLAS Offline Software
Loading...
Searching...
No Matches
sg-dump Namespace Reference

Functions

 _str_to_slice (slice_str)

Variables

str __version__ = "$Revision: 1.4 $"
str __author__ = "Sebastien Binet <binet@cern.ch>"
str __doc__
 parser
 _add = parser.add_option
 dest
 default
 help
 type
 action
 options
 args
list input_files = []
 msg = logging.getLogger ('sg-dumper')
int sc = 1
 out
 files
 output
 nevts
 skip
 dump_jobo
 pyalg_cls
 include
 exclude
 do_clean_up
 athena_opts
 conditions_tag
 full_log

Function Documentation

◆ _str_to_slice()

sg-dump._str_to_slice ( slice_str)
protected
translate a string into a python slice

Definition at line 31 of file sg-dump.py.

31def _str_to_slice (slice_str):
32 """translate a string into a python slice
33 """
34 sl= [int(s) if s != '' else None for s in slice_str.split(':')]
35 if len(sl)==2:
36 sl.append (None)
37 assert len(sl)==3, 'invalid input slice string'
38 start = sl[0]
39 stop = sl[1]
40 step = sl[2]
41 return slice (start, stop, step)
42

Variable Documentation

◆ __author__

str sg-dump.__author__ = "Sebastien Binet <binet@cern.ch>"
private

Definition at line 21 of file sg-dump.py.

◆ __doc__

str sg-dump.__doc__
private
Initial value:
1= """\
2a simple python script to run pyathena and use PySgDumper to dump
3a (set of) event(s) from a POOL (esd/aod) file into an ASCII file\
4"""

Definition at line 22 of file sg-dump.py.

◆ __version__

str sg-dump.__version__ = "$Revision: 1.4 $"
private

Definition at line 20 of file sg-dump.py.

◆ _add

sg-dump._add = parser.add_option
protected

Definition at line 48 of file sg-dump.py.

◆ action

sg-dump.action

Definition at line 79 of file sg-dump.py.

◆ args

sg-dump.args

Definition at line 121 of file sg-dump.py.

◆ athena_opts

sg-dump.athena_opts

Definition at line 152 of file sg-dump.py.

◆ conditions_tag

sg-dump.conditions_tag

Definition at line 153 of file sg-dump.py.

◆ default

sg-dump.default

Definition at line 52 of file sg-dump.py.

◆ dest

sg-dump.dest

Definition at line 51 of file sg-dump.py.

◆ do_clean_up

sg-dump.do_clean_up

Definition at line 151 of file sg-dump.py.

◆ dump_jobo

sg-dump.dump_jobo

Definition at line 147 of file sg-dump.py.

◆ exclude

sg-dump.exclude

Definition at line 150 of file sg-dump.py.

◆ files

sg-dump.files

Definition at line 143 of file sg-dump.py.

◆ full_log

sg-dump.full_log

Definition at line 154 of file sg-dump.py.

◆ help

sg-dump.help

Definition at line 53 of file sg-dump.py.

◆ include

sg-dump.include

Definition at line 149 of file sg-dump.py.

◆ input_files

list sg-dump.input_files = []

Definition at line 123 of file sg-dump.py.

◆ msg

sg-dump.msg = logging.getLogger ('sg-dumper')

Definition at line 126 of file sg-dump.py.

◆ nevts

sg-dump.nevts

Definition at line 145 of file sg-dump.py.

◆ options

sg-dump.options

Definition at line 121 of file sg-dump.py.

◆ out

sg-dump.out

Definition at line 142 of file sg-dump.py.

◆ output

sg-dump.output

Definition at line 144 of file sg-dump.py.

◆ parser

sg-dump.parser
Initial value:
1= OptionParser(
2 usage="usage: %prog [options] -o out.ascii in1.pool "\
3 "[in2.pool [in3.pool [...]]]"
4 )

Definition at line 44 of file sg-dump.py.

◆ pyalg_cls

sg-dump.pyalg_cls

Definition at line 148 of file sg-dump.py.

◆ sc

sg-dump.sc = 1

Definition at line 140 of file sg-dump.py.

◆ skip

sg-dump.skip

Definition at line 146 of file sg-dump.py.

◆ type

sg-dump.type

Definition at line 59 of file sg-dump.py.